Live From Anime Weekend Atlanta: Toonami 1997-2008

September 20th, 2008 by Chad Bonin

From the floor of Anime Weekend Atlanta, I’m both glad and saddened to be the one breaking the news. Tonight’s Toonami will be the final. Anime will be shuffled off, with Adult Swim still apparently acquiring some, and Action will be a Friday Night/Saturday Morning thing. The Toonami people have been shuffled off to different departments of CN, and Jetstream will air for the forseeable future, but the Toonami we know is gone as of tonight.

Naruto? S&P has 15 more episodes to go over, and there’s no word on another season. No word, also, where it will air after Toonami.
